Abstract

The invention discloses an ultrasonic treatment probe which comprises a sound guiding device and first and second acoustical devices, wherein the sound guiding device comprises a liquid box that accommodates a sound guiding liquid; the first acoustical device comprises an acoustic transmission surface, and is used for converting electric energy into acoustic waves in an acoustic energy form and emitting the acoustic waves through the acoustic transmission surface; the second acoustical device comprises an acoustic inlet surface and an acoustic outlet surface, the acoustic inlet surface coversthe acoustic transmission surface, and the second acoustical device receives acoustic waves through the acoustic inlet surface and emits the acoustic waves from the acoustic outlet surface; the acoustic impedance of the second acoustical device is smaller than that of the first acoustical device and larger than that of the sound guiding liquid, and the liquid box is in sealed connection with the second acoustical device, so that the sound guiding liquid is in sealed contact with the acoustic outlet surface. The invention further discloses ultrasonic treatment equipment comprising the ultrasonic treatment probe. According to the ultrasonic treatment probe and the equipment, bubbles in the sound guiding liquid therein can be reduced, and a treated receptor is prevented from being scalded dueto sound wave energy accumulation.

technical field [0001] The invention relates to the technical field of acoustic devices. More specifically, the present invention relates to ultrasound therapy probes and devices. Background technique [0002] In the existing ultrasonic therapy probes and equipment, during the transmission of sound waves from the ultrasonic therapy probe to the receptor, the accumulation of sound energy will occur, which will cause the temperature of the ultrasonic therapy probe to rise, thereby causing the risk of scalding the patient.
